protected override async Task OnInitializedAsync() { StarsList = new List <int> { 1, 2, 3, 4, 5 }; NullOption = "None"; BackRoute = $"ninjas/{Id}"; NinjaModel = await NinjaViewModelService.GetNinja(long.Parse(Id)); Mysteries = await MysteryViewModel.GetMysteryList(); Attacks = await AttackViewModel.GetAttackList(); Chases = await ChaseViewModel.GetChaseList(); Passives = await PassiveViewModel.GetPassiveList(); MysIdString = NinjaModel.MysteryId.ToString(); AttIdString = NinjaModel.AttackId.ToString(); if (NinjaModel.ChaseId1 != null) { ChaseId1S = NinjaModel.ChaseId1.ToString(); } else { ChaseId1S = NullOption; } if (NinjaModel.ChaseId2 != null) { ChaseId2S = NinjaModel.ChaseId2.ToString(); } else { ChaseId2S = NullOption; } if (NinjaModel.ChaseId3 != null) { ChaseId3S = NinjaModel.ChaseId3.ToString(); } else { ChaseId3S = NullOption; } if (NinjaModel.PassiveId1 != null) { PassiveId1S = NinjaModel.PassiveId1.ToString(); } else { PassiveId1S = NullOption; } if (NinjaModel.PassiveId2 != null) { PassiveId2S = NinjaModel.PassiveId2.ToString(); } else { PassiveId2S = NullOption; } if (NinjaModel.PassiveId3 != null) { PassiveId3S = NinjaModel.PassiveId3.ToString(); } else { PassiveId3S = NullOption; } StarsString = NinjaModel.Stars.ToString(); NinjaViewModel = NinjaModel; }
protected override async Task OnInitializedAsync() { ChaseList = await ChaseViewModel.GetChaseList(); FilteredList = ChaseList; }
protected override async Task OnInitializedAsync() { NullOption = "None"; Mysteries = await MysteryViewModel.GetMysteryList(); Attacks = await AttackViewModel.GetAttackList(); Chases = await ChaseViewModel.GetChaseList(); Passives = await PassiveViewModel.GetPassiveList(); if (NinjaModel.ChaseId1 != null) { ChaseId1S = NinjaModel.ChaseId1.ToString(); } else { ChaseId1S = NullOption; } if (NinjaModel.ChaseId2 != null) { ChaseId2S = NinjaModel.ChaseId2.ToString(); } else { ChaseId2S = NullOption; } if (NinjaModel.ChaseId3 != null) { ChaseId3S = NinjaModel.ChaseId3.ToString(); } else { ChaseId3S = NullOption; } if (NinjaModel.PassiveId1 != null) { PassiveId1S = NinjaModel.PassiveId1.ToString(); } else { PassiveId1S = NullOption; } if (NinjaModel.PassiveId2 != null) { PassiveId2S = NinjaModel.PassiveId2.ToString(); } else { PassiveId2S = NullOption; } if (NinjaModel.PassiveId3 != null) { PassiveId3S = NinjaModel.PassiveId3.ToString(); } else { PassiveId3S = NullOption; } StarsString = NinjaModel.Stars.ToString(); NinjaViewModel = NinjaModel; }